What is quality control in solar panel manufacturing?

Quality control in solar panel manufacturing involves ensuring that each step of the production process meets the necessary standards. There are three types of quality control in solar production namely in-process quality control, final inspection, and testing and validation. In-Process Quality Control

What is a solar panel final inspection?

Final Inspection The final inspection involves inspecting the finished product to ensure that it meets the necessary quality standards. This involves checking the physical appearance of the solar panel, ensuring that all components are properly installed, and ensuring that the panel is functioning as intended.

How much power does a 300 watt solar panel produce?

Under ideal sunlight conditions, a 300 Watt solar panel has the potential to produce 300 Watts (0.3 kW) of power, or even a little bit more. However, in reality, the power output of a 300 Watt solar panel typically ranges from 100 to 250 Watts (0.1 to 0.25 kW). But it’s rated at 300 Watts, shouldn’t it produce 300 Watts of power?
